Filing 2 ORDER: The Court severs from this action, under Rule 21 of the Federal Rules of Civil Procedure, the habeas corpus claims of Petitioners Harris, Maxwell, McVay, Walters, Reid, Washington, Halley, Stevens, Scales, and Williams. Petitioner Mayo will proceed as the sole petitioner in this action, and he is directed, within 30 days, to either pay the $5.00 filing fee to bring this action or complete, sign, and submit the attached IFP application under this action's docket number, 1:22-CV-5810 (LTS). No answer shall be required as this time. If Petitioner Mayo complies with this order, this action shall be processed in accordance with the procedures of the Clerks Office. If Petitioner Mayo fails to comply with this order within the time allowed, the Court will dismiss this action. The Court directs the Clerk of Court to open 10 new separate habeas corpus actions with 10 new civil docket numbers for the claims of Petitioners Harris, Maxwell, McVay, Walters, Reid, Washington, Halley, Stevens, Scales, and Williams, respectively, and docket in each of those habeas corpus actions a copy of the petition and this order. Once each new action is opened, the Court will issue orders directing Petitioners Harris, Maxwell, McVay, Walters, Reid, Washington, Halley, Stevens, Scales, and Williams to each either pay the $5.00 filing fee to bring a separate habeas corpus action or complete, sign, and submit an IFP application. Because the petition makes no substantial showing of a denial of a constitutional right, a certificate of appealability will not issue. See 28 U.S.C. 2253. SO ORDERED. (Signed by Judge Laura Taylor Swain on 7/29/22) (Attachments: #1 Attachment) (rdz) |
